可扩展Hadoop任务分配模块的研究与实现
MapReduce是一种应用广泛的并行编程模型,Hadoop是MapReduce的开源实现。为了满足不同类型的MapReduce作业对任务分配策略的特殊需求,在深入分析Hadoop固有任务分配机制的基础上,设计并实现了一种可扩展的任务分配模块,用户可以根据作业的特性实现并加载自定义的任务分配器。在可扩展的任务分配模块的基础上实现了两个典型的任务分配器,实验结果表明使用可扩展任务分配模块并加载适用于特定作业的任务分配器能够显著地缩短作业的执行时间,提高Hadoop的处理性能。
计算机系统 任务分配模块 优化设计 数据管理
Zhao Baoxue 赵保学 Li Zhanhuai 李战怀 Chen Qun 陈群 Jiang Tao 姜涛 Pan Wei 潘巍 Jin Jian 金健
School of Computer Science, Northwestern Polytechnical University, Xi”an 710002 西北工业大学计算机学院 西安 710072
国内会议
合肥
中文
120-126
2012-10-01(万方平台首次上网日期,不代表论文的发表时间)